R.E.M.’s New Album Accelerate

April 6th, 2008 . by Roxor

American Idol ChikezieWhew! It’s been quite awhile since R.E.M released any sort of album. What took so long? Who knows! Their first album in nearly four years, Accelerate is a total rock victory for the band. Accelerate is the first album by R.E.M. absent Bill Berry who quit in 1997. When the popular drummer left the band, singer Michael Stipe was quoted as saying that R.E.M. had become a “three-legged dog” with Berry’s departure. Stipe, guitarist Peter Buck and bassist Mike Mills have continued as the dynamic trio and kept R.E.M. alive.

Accelerate becomes the group’s first studio album in four years. Ultimately, I must say that R.E.M. sounds whole again, which is probably the best thing about this album. R.E.M. is no longer the “three-legged dog” they claimed to be in the past – they are now complete in their purpose. Stipe sings at the end of his record, “Music will provide the light you cannot resist” and “I’m Gonna’ DJ.” You can surely believe him — as Stipe and his band believe in themselves once again.
